What is the B1 Visa?
The B1 is a versatile eVisa or Visa on Arrival (VoA) designed for travelers who want the best of both worlds. It’s a single-entry permit that grants you an initial 30-day stay, with the flexibility to extend for another 30 days once you’re in the country.
Whether you apply online before you fly or grab it at the airport, it’s the most effortless way for eligible citizens to step into Indonesia.
Work Meets Play: What Can You Do?
The beauty of the B1 Visa lies in its balance. It’s not just for sightseeing; it’s for the modern professional who values spontaneity. With this visa, you are authorized to:
Explore & Rejuvenate: Dive into general tourism, visit friends and family, or seek wellness at world-class medical facilities.
Talk Business: Host meetings, lead negotiations, and sign those all-important contracts.
Site Inspections: Get eyes on the ground. You can visit offices, factories, or production sites to ensure everything is running smoothly.
MICE & Events: Stay ahead of the curve by attending industry conventions, exhibitions, and professional incentives.
Niche Travel: Even if you’re arriving by yacht or looking for personal development courses, the B1 has you covered.
The Fine Print (Simplified)
We know logistics can be a bore, so we’ve kept the essentials clear and easy to follow:
Stay Duration: 30 Days (plus a one-time 30-day extension).
Investment: The visa fee is IDR 850.000, a small price for a world of opportunity.
Entry Window: Once issued, you have 90 days to make your grand entrance into Indonesia.
Passport Power: Ensure your passport is valid for at least 6 months from your arrival date.
Your Ticket Out: Have a confirmed outbound flight ready to show at immigration.
Staying Savvy: A Few Friendly Reminders
To keep your stay stress-free and avoid any “vacation vibes” interruptions, there are a few things to keep in mind. The B1 Visa is a non-remunerated visa. This means:
No Local Paychecks: You cannot accept wages or rewards from Indonesian companies or individuals.
No Commercial Sales: Selling physical goods or services locally is off-limits.
Respect the Culture: Indonesia is a land of rich tradition. Always adhere to local laws and respect the beautiful customs of our islands.
Overstaying or working illegally can lead to fines or even a “see you later” (deportation) you didn’t plan for. Let’s keep your record as clear as our turquoise waters!
